Antuan Company set the following standard costs per unit for its product. Direct materials (5.0 pounds @ $6.00 per pound) $ 30.00 Direct labor (1.9 hours @ $11.00 per hour) 20.90 Overhead (1.9 hours @ $18.50 per hour) 35.15 Standard cost per unit $ 86.05 The standard overhead rate ($18.50 per direct labor hour) is based on a predicted activity level of 75% of the factory’s capacity of 20,000 units per month. Following are the company’s budgeted overhead costs per month at the 75% capacity level. Overhead Budget (75% Capacity) Variable overhead costs   Indirect materials $ 30,000 Indirect labor 75,000 Power 30,000 Maintenance 30,000 Total variable overhead costs 165,000 Fixed overhead costs   Depreciation—Building 24,000 Depreciation—Machinery 70,000 Taxes and insurance 18,000 Supervisory salaries 250,250 Total fixed overhead costs 362,250 Total overhead costs $ 527,250 The company incurred the following actual costs when it operated at 75% of capacity in October. Direct materials (76,000 pounds @ $6.10 per pound)   $ 463,600 Direct labor (19,000 hours @ $11.20 per hour)   212,800 Overhead costs     Indirect materials $ 41,950   Indirect labor 176,200   Power 34,500   Maintenance 34,500   Depreciation—Building 24,000   Depreciation—Machinery 94,500   Taxes and insurance 16,200   Supervisory salaries 250,250 672,100 Total costs   $ 1,348,500   Required: 1. Prepare flexible overhead budgets for October showing amounts of each variable and fixed cost at the 65%, 75%, and 85% capacity levels.
